Which evasion aids can assist you with making contact with the local population?

Answer :

Pointee-Talkee and Cultural Smart Cards are the evasion aids that can assist you with making contact with the local population.

Information or equipment to assist a person in avoiding capture in evasion and recovery operations. evasion aids include, but are not limited to, blood counters, pointing talkies, dodge cards, barter items, and gear designed to complement issued survival gear.
